I am trying desperately to get a Bluetooth dongle working with my Arduino but I can't send it a command that it needs. I can use it when I plug it into my computer via a USB to UART chip and send the command (C) from PuTTY and then press Enter.

The Bluetooth dongle's command sheet says that the command I am trying to send it C<cr> but I can't figure out how to send the proper carriage return character from the Arduino code. I have tried using the Serial.println() function as well as adding the \r character to my current Serial.write("C\r") but neither of those are working.

How can I achieve this?

Interestingly, I can report the opposite on Win 7: PuTTY for me and my embedded project is sending ONLY '\r' over the COM port. Curious, read: frustraitingly unexplainable, but I simply look for either character on the other end of the serial connection.

Then, if you enable 'Implicit LF in every CR' under Terminal options it will send both '\r\n'. Default behaviour seems to be akin to a Commodore machine :D (http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Newline)... who knew...

PuTTY emulates xterm which emulates vt100. To have putty send CR/LF when pressing enter, type ESC[20h in putty after connecting to the serial device. This sets VT100 LNM true.

On arduino program, just use Serial.write and both characters codes:

Serial.write(13);    // CR
Serial.write(10);    // LF

And Avoid Serial.print as it is intended as human readable, so formatted.

Yesterday I was trying with this by other problem. In standard configuration (on Windows and Linux) if You type "help" and then press enter on serial port will appear followed chain of bits (checked with external connected terminal via RS232, and logic analyzer):

0x68(h) 0x65(e) 0x6c(l) 0x70(p) 0x0d(CR: Carriage Return U+000A)

so seems like PUTTY puts CR on ENTER (no matter if You are on Linux or Windows)
